.Belo Horizonte, Brazil
Belo Horizonte is the capital of the state of Minas Gerais. This year Belô or BH, as it´s known in Brazil, will celebrate its 100th anniversary. What a party cityhall has planned! Belo Horizonte is surrounded by the beautiful Serra do Curral mountain range. The air is pure and refreshing. The average yearly temperature is 75 F. The sunrise in the East and the sunsets in the West are often spectacular, hence the name, beautiful horizon.

The city is Brazil´s third largest. The state is the second largest GDP producer. While there are many social problems, this city of almost three million is the best place to live in all of Latin and South America! (Rand-Mcnally, 1994) The city was planned by its forefathers to accomodate up to 100,000 inhabitants. Many of the folks who cannot afford the glitzier "centro", have been pushed up into the mountains overlooking the city and into the poorer outer suburbs in classic third world style. There are plenty diversions including some of the best food and drink in South America. Many beautiful, lush, and tropical parks offer families much needed breathing room and exercise. Lake Pampulha and Praça da Liberdade are popular tourist destinations.
